Understanding Beli Manastir's Continental Climate
In general, Beli Manastir's climate fits within the Köppen climate classification as a humid continental climate (Dfa). This results in warm to hot summers and cold winters. Precipitation is distributed fairly evenly throughout the year, although there can be noticeable dry spells during summer months.
Seasonal Weather Characteristics
Spring in Beli Manastir
Spring emerges with a gradual increase in temperature, commencing in March and lasting through May. This season is marked by ascending warmth and the reawakening of flora throughout the region. The average temperature ranges from 5°C to 18°C (41°F to 64°F).
Summer in Beli Manastir
From June to August, Beli Manastir basks in warm to hot weather. The temperatures can reach an average high of 25°C to 30°C (77°F to 86°F) during the daytime, with occasional heatwaves propelling those numbers higher. The evenings offer a cooler reprieve with average lows from 13°C to 16°C (55°F to 61°F).
Autumn in Beli Manastir
During September to November, the town experiences a sharp drop in temperature, foreshadowing winter. This season is typically characterized by a gradual decrease in temperatures along with an increase in precipitation. The average temperature range is from 10°C to 20°C (50°F to 68°F).
Winter in Beli Manastir
The winter season, spanning December to February, sees Beli Manastir turning into a chilly locale with snowfall being a common occurrence. Average daytime temperatures hover around 0°C to 5°C (32°F to 41°F), while nighttime averages can plummet below freezing.

Climate Influencers
The climate in Beli Manastir is influenced by several geographical and atmospheric factors:
- The Pannonian Basin, which impacts the climatic systems with its mostly flat terrain and affects the movement of air masses.
- The Danube River, which provides moisture and can moderate the climate to some extent.
- Proximity to continental climatic systems from Eastern Europe, which contributes to the cold winters and warm summers.
